Transaction 38d7c6f26759050800bb90afcad6b95bede23f87086da797e9aa1f341ee01ed6
1 Input
1 Output
-
38d7c6f26759050800bb90afcad6b95bede23f87086da797e9aa1f341ee01ed6:0
- value
- 999460
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d6a22de343f27f2f4b39774cf807706d62c55fc68107083bdfa910c9b377fdb3
- address
- tb1p663zmc6r7flj7jeewax0spmsd43v2h7xsyrssw7l4ygvnvmhlkesr3vv2s